Concept of Keesa-e-Khusyat-ur-Rahem (Ovarian Cyst) in Unani medicine: A review

Abstract
The ovaries are pelvic organ found in the female reproductive system situated at either side of the uterus that produces an ovum and the hormones. Hormones which are released by ovaries are estrogen and progesterone. These hormones responsible for growth of the female genital organs like breast, body shape, body hair, menstrual and pregnancy. There are so many diseases occur in the ovaries like Endometriosis, Ovarian cyst, Cancer, Ovarian, Ovarian Low Malignant Potential Tumor. In Unani system of the medicine the terminology for Keesa-e-Khusyat-ur-Rahem (Ovarian cyst). Disease not have been defined under the heading of Ovarain cyst as disease has been categorized recently just a century before. The description of the disease has been described by various Unani physicians under the heading of Ehtabas-Tams (Amenorrhoea). Uterine disorders mainly occur due to Su-e-Mizaj-e-Rahem (Abnormal temperament of the uterus) which is also responsible for formation of Su-e-Mizaj-e-Khusyat-ur-Reham (Abnormal temperament of the ovaries). According to the theory of the four Akhlat (Humours). Main Khilt for the development of the Ehtabas-Tams (Amenorrohea) is phlegm and black bile. Phlegm is responsible for the development of the Kees formation in the Khusyat-ur-Rahem.
